| I was finally able to upload some photos. Above is an example of our first challenge to write one's name with LEGO bricks. It spells "Vivian". |
![]() |
| Our second challenge was to build the tallest "earthquake proof" structure possible with 100 bricks. |
![]() |
| We worked together in groups of two and rebuilt the structures multiple times to make them taller and stronger. The "earthquake table" is behind the structure above. |
![]() |
| The teams weren't opposed to breaking down the structure to start all over and make it better. That attitude is critical when problem solving. |

For our first challenge the students made their names with LEGO bricks. On day two the challenge was to make the highest earthquake proof structure possible with 100 bricks. We used an earthquake table to test it. The highest structure in our group was 21 inches!
